Web80386 Microprocessor is a 32-bit processor that holds the ability to carry out 32-bit operations in one cycle. It has a data and address bus of 32-bit each. Thus has the ability to address 4 GB (or 2 32) of physical memory.. WebSep 25, 2024 · 1. x64 refers to 64 bit architectures. Rather confusingly x86 refers to 32 bit systems. The maximum address space is calculated by simply raising 2^n e.g. for 32 bits it is 2^32 = 4294967296 (4 Gigabytes). For 64 bit the possible address space is rather large. 2^64 = 1.8446744e+19. WebIntel 8086 uses 20 address lines and 16 data- lines. It can directly address up to 2 20 = 1 Mbyte of memory. It consists of a powerful instruction set, which provides operation like division and multiplication very quickly. 8086 is designed to operate in two modes, i.e., Minimum and Maximum mode.
